How To Fix FUND_FAREA_DRF048 - Failed to set delete flag for Functional Area &1


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: FUND_FAREA_DRF - Message class for Functional Area replication

  • Message number: 048

  • Message text: Failed to set delete flag for Functional Area &1

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message FUND_FAREA_DRF048 - Failed to set delete flag for Functional Area &1 ?

    The SAP error message FUND_FAREA_DRF048 indicates that there was a failure in setting the delete flag for a functional area in the Funds Management (FM) module. This error typically arises when there are issues related to the functional area being referenced, such as dependencies or constraints that prevent it from being deleted.

    Causes:

    1. Dependencies: The functional area may be linked to existing transactions, budget allocations, or other data that prevent it from being deleted.
    2.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ary permissions to delete or modify the functional area.
    3. Data Integrity Constraints: There may be data integrity rules in place that prevent the deletion of the functional area if it is still in use.
    4. System Configuration: There could be configuration settings in the Funds Management module that restrict the deletion of functional areas.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Dependencies: Review any existing transactions, budgets, or allocations that are associated with the functional area. You may need to clear or reassign these before attempting to delete the functional area.
    2. Review Authorizations: Ensure that the user attempting to delete the functional area has the necessary authorizations. This can be checked in the user roles and profiles.
    3. Data Cleanup: If there are any records that reference the functional area, consider cleaning them up or reassigning them to another functional area.
    4. Consult Documentation: Review SAP documentation or notes related to the Funds Management module for any specific guidelines on deleting functional areas.
    5. Use Transaction Codes: Utilize transaction codes like FMAVCR01 (for budget control) or FMF1 (for functional area management) to check the status and dependencies of the functional area.
    6. Contact SAP Support: If the issue persists, consider reaching out to SAP support for assistance, especially if it appears to be a system or configuration issue.
